Two weeks ago, a couple of us headed up to The Salt Flats, in Nowhere, Oklahoma (actually it's near Cherokee.) It also just happened to be the coldest day all winter with 35 mph winds, making the windchill 11 degrees F.

But thanks to the Staples' stubbornness, and the 2 1/2 hour drive to get out there, we proceeded with the shoot.

Miserable, doesn't even begin to describe it. Ben, our one and only actor, was an amazing sport about the whole thing. All of the crew was bundled up, but Ben was out there with nothing on his ears or his hands, and I didn't even hear him complain. In the end, the short turned out great!

Staples has already finished the edit and we're preparing for the web. It'll be on our websites March 20th.
